免责声明

易百易数码科技

关系型数据库和非关系型数据库的区别(关系型数据库和非关系型数据库的区别和特点)

什么是关系型数据库

关系型数据库简单的可以理解为二维数据库,表的格式就如Excel,有行有列。常用的关系数据库有Oracle,SqlServer,Informix,MySql,SyBase等。

2、缺点:表结构不直观,实现复杂,速度慢

关系型数据库和非关系型数据库的区别(关系型数据库和非关系型数据库的区别和特点)-图1

3、优点:健壮性高,社区庞大。

关系数据库的型与值分别是什么

关系数据库系统是支持关系模型的数据库系统。

关系数据库系统与关系模式是两个层次的概念,他们都由型与值两方面组成。型是静态的、稳定的,值是在数据库更新过程中不断改变的。

关系型数据库和非关系型数据库的区别(关系型数据库和非关系型数据库的区别和特点)-图2

关系数据库的型 = 关系数据库模式 = 对若干域的定义 + 对这些域上的关系模式的定义

关系数据库的值 = 若干关系模式在特定时刻对应关系的集合 = 若干关系模式的值的集合

关系模式的型 = 属性的集合 + 属性与域之间映像的集合

关系型数据库和非关系型数据库的区别(关系型数据库和非关系型数据库的区别和特点)-图3

关系模式的值 = 关系 = 特定时刻内该关系模式描述下的取值

数据库分为哪几类

数据库可以分为关系型数据库、非关系型数据库和面向对象数据库等几类。

关系型数据库以表格的形式存储数据,使用SQL语言进行查询和操作,如MySQL、Oracle等。

非关系型数据库以键值对、文档、列族等形式存储数据,适用于大数据和分布式环境,如MongoDB、Redis等。

面向对象数据库将数据以对象的形式存储,支持面向对象的数据建模和查询,如PostgreSQL、DB2等。此外,还有图数据库、时序数据库等特定领域的数据库。不同类型的数据库适用于不同的应用场景和数据结构,选择合适的数据库可以提高数据管理和查询效率。

到此,以上就是小编对于关系型数据库和非关系型数据库的区别和特点的问题就介绍到这了,希望介绍的3点解答对大家有用,有任何问题和不懂的,欢迎各位老师在评论区讨论,给我留言。

分享:
扫描分享到社交APP
上一篇
下一篇